Is there any particular reason why the key commands Mixer>Hide: Audio, Hide: Groups, Hide: Instruments etc. only work when one of the three mixers is open and not in the project window even though they are part of the project window options other than Input and Output Channels.

Also as a side note, the key command name is deceptive, this seems like it should really be called Toggle View: Audio, Toggle View: Groups etc. since it doesn’t just hide them with the key command.

If there is another way to just hide Instrument and MIDI tracks in the Project window, without doing it based on track name, and regardless of if they have MIDI events on them yet, with the PLE or some other way that would be great to know.

The Macro’s I Use for audio that that always works regardless of window are the following.

Macro - Track View 01 - Hide Only Audio Tracks
Project - Bring To Front
Process Project Logical Editor – Hide All Audio Tracks
Macro - Track View 01 - Show Only Audio Tracks Project
Bring To Front
Process Project Logical Editor - Hide All Tracks
Process Project Logical Editor - Show All Audio Tracks
Macro - Track View 01 - Toggle Only Audio Tracks Project
Bring To Front
Process Project Logical Editor - Toggle All Audio Tracks


Audio tracks are simple with the PLE, the problem with these is it always brings the focus to the Project window because the PLE will not work otherwise (which would solve a lot of other problems if it did always work regardless of window focus).
